Traditional Phone VS Internet Phone
Phone service is a game that has changed over the years and is still evolving. Internet phone providers are able to heavily compete with traditional phone providers. Changing from traditional to internet can be a big decision to make, so weighing the pluses and minuses is a must. The traditional landline is an establishment that can always be counted on. During stormy weather you are less likely to lose a dial tone and don’t need anything but a phone for operation. However the monthly cost of a landline can be more than double that of an internet phone. Having an internet phone has a lower cost and allows the use of several features such as call forwarding at no additional charges. Internet plans often allow unlimited calls and can permit calls to areas outside the US for no fee or for a lower fee. Traditional phone service can charge you per feature, per call, and for calls outside of the US. The traditional landline certainly still has its advantages, just as the internet phone has its own advantages. If you are looking for a phone service that is less expensive, then the internet phone is for you. If you are looking for a phone that is available during stormy weather, then the traditional phone is for you.

Relationship Repair
Mending a broken relationship is like opening up a wound that is subject to never being fixed. Sometimes relationships can’t be fixed; but when a person feels that a relationship is worth trying to fix, then precautions should be taken. Taking steps to fix a relationship requires that all people approach the situation in a calm manner. When having the necessary conversations to make an old relationship exist again, those involved must be sure to never point the blame at the other person, or kick (metaphorically speaking) the other person as they accept and apologize for their blame. Even if you don’t feel as though you’ve done anything wrong, Making up also means taking the initiate to make a genuine apology. You can say that you feel sorry for how things turned out, or for all feelings that were hurt, or for some other aspect of the situation. Apologizing for an aspect allows you to make a less direct apology that may not seem as genuine, but making up has to start somewhere. As you work on repairing a damaged relationship, do a little at a time and set the ground rules. It is best that all parties make an effort to talk about the behaviors they will do differently to make the relationship better. All parties should come up with and document a plan for how to treat others, what to do when anger enters the situation, and the process of resolving any future problems. The ground rules can change as the relationships gets better. Never give up and remember that what you want from the other(s) must be something that you are willing to give.

Identity Monitoring
A person’s identity is stolen several times a day. Not only is it difficult to correct, but you have to prove who you are first to get the law on your side. Keeping your identity safe is a fact of life that requires daily monitoring. Most people try their best to make sure they keep a good track on their personal identification cards. Yet is it rare that those looking to steal someone’s identity will do so by getting physical possession of a person’s personal identification cards. There are numerous other ways a person’s identity can be stolen and checking your credit every few months is wise, but no longer enough. It is difficult for a person to check their identity daily and it isn’t cost effective either, unless this is done through an identity monitoring service. Identity monitoring services are becoming more available due to a drastic rise in identity theft. These identity monitoring services offer assurance and insurance. They offer assurance because every time your identity is used without your permission an alert is sent to you letting you know. This immediate alert allows you to stop the damage quickly and may even lead to the apprehension of a suspect. More importantly having identity monitoring establishes a prior form of connection of identifying who you are legally and who the fraudulent person is illegally. Identity monitoring offers insurance because if your identity is stolen the financial losses you suffer may be covered on your behalf. The money you loss may be applied to your accounts, your expenses to replace identity cards and other information damaged due to someone fraudulently misrepresenting you can refunded, and many other problems can be corrected by the service on your behalf. Having a service to alert you and help to get your identity back is surely worth it. Having an identity monitoring service can reduce the numerous tasks needed to be done to prove who you are legally. Having help is a big advantage among many and is a huge step to reclaiming your identity swiftly.

Omega 3 Foods
Love salmon, halibut, tuna, collard greens and walnuts? Great, these are some of the foods that have omega 3 fatty acids that your body needs. Your body needs omega 3 fatty acids to prevent diseases like, high blood pressure, arthritis, cancer, diabetes, lupus, multiple sclerosis, and more. These omega 3 fatty acids that can be found in various foods are important to the human body because they protect your arteries from thickening and give your body nutrients needed to function at best. Various products are being made to include omega 3 in the product, such as: Smart Balance cooking oil and butter, Yoplait yogurt, Eggland’s Best Eggs, Tropicana Healthy Heart Orange Juice, and Silk Milk. Many products are starting to include omega 3 fatty acids and hopefully there won’t be a difficult transition you’ll need to make to your diet to ensure you get all the omega 3 fatty acids your body needs.
